是的,两个不同的用户可以访问同一个数据库表来插入不同的数据。数据库表是用来存储和组织数据的结构,它可以被多个用户同时访问和操作。每个用户可以通过数据库管理系统(DBMS)提供的权限控制机制来限制对表的访问和操作权限。
在数据库中,可以为每个用户创建独立的账号,并为其分配不同的权限。通过授权和权限管理,可以确保不同的用户只能访问其被授权的表,并且只能插入属于自己的数据。这样,即使多个用户同时访问同一个数据库表,也不会发生数据冲突或混淆。
对于MySQL数据库,可以使用GRANT语句为用户分配权限,例如:
GRANT INSERT ON database.table TO 'user1'@'localhost'; GRANT INSERT ON database.table TO 'user2'@'localhost';
这样,user1和user2就可以分别访问表并插入各自的数据。
对于腾讯云的数据库产品,推荐使用腾讯云数据库MySQL版(TencentDB for MySQL)。它是一种高性能、可扩展的关系型数据库服务,提供了丰富的功能和工具来管理和保护数据。您可以通过腾讯云控制台或API来创建和管理数据库实例,并为不同的用户设置权限和访问控制规则。
更多关于腾讯云数据库MySQL版的信息,请访问以下链接:
请注意,以上答案仅供参考,具体的数据库访问和权限控制方式可能因不同的数据库管理系统和云服务提供商而有所差异。
领取专属 10元无门槛券
手把手带您无忧上云